GARY STROUTSOS

A self-taught ethnomusicologist, American Indian historian and long time classical and jazz flutist, Gary Stroutsos began playing American Indian wooden flutes in the mid-1980's. He brings his own cultural references and jazz stylings to his music, making it unlike that of any other artist working in this genre.

Stroutsos has studied many wood flute styles by playing alongside Native American flutists such as Kevin Locke, Keith Bear, Joseph Fire Crow and Bryan Akipa. The differences between Stroutsos and other artists include his jazz-like improvisation in certain passages (specially in concert), his inclusion of musicians from around the world and his breathing techniques.
